One of the main reasons for performing a flexible cystoscopy is to investigate urinary tract symptoms such as blood in the urine, pain during urination, or frequent urination. It can also be used to diagnose and monitor conditions such as bladder cancer, bladder stones, and urinary tract infections.

During the procedure, your doctor guides a narrow, flexible scope through the urethra into the bladder. It can help your doctor identify whether an enlarged prostate is blocking urine flow.
WebApr 2, 2024 · A cystoscopy is a procedure to look inside your urethra and bladder using a cystoscope. A cystoscope is a small tube with a light and magnifying camera on the end. The procedure is used to diagnose and treat conditions of the bladder, urethra, or prostate. Your healthcare provider may also do a ureteroscopy during a cystoscopy. Webalternative. However, it may be essential to have a cystoscopy in order to diagnose some bladder conditions. Your Specialist Nurse or Doctor will discuss these options with you if appropriate. Another form of cystoscopy, using a rigid rather than a flexible instrument can be used for giving treatment to the bladder and urinary tract.

Your doctor may use a thin, flexible tube to check inside your bladder. This is called a cystoscopy. The thin tube is called a cystoscope. It has optic fibres inside it, and a light and eyepiece at one end. The doctor can see down the cystoscope to look at the pictures. For example, it may be possible to remove a bladder tumor or growth by passing surgical tools through the cystoscope, thus precluding the need for more extensive surgery.
